You'll feel at home the moment you enter this oversized studio apartment. Nothing says New York quite like this charming alcove studio, filled with classic Art Deco details and generous living space.
Upon entering, you're welcomed by an oversized foyer offering flexible space ideal for a home office. Step down into the expansive sunken living area, complete with a separate sleeping alcove that creates a distinct and comfortable layout.
This Art Deco gem features beamed ceilings, herringbone hardwood floors, and beautiful period details throughout. The updated kitchen includes granite countertops, while the bathroom is tastefully finished with classic tile work. Three roomy closets provide excellent storage. *The apartment is located on a raised 1st floor - not at ground level*
Building amenities include a part-time doorman (Sun.- Wed. 12-8pm and Thurs. - Sat. 8am-12am), resident superintendent, full-time porter, on-site laundry room, and two elevators. Pied-à-terre and investor friendly.
Current capital assessments: $98.41/month through 12/2027 and $212.56/month through 7/2028.
